Il Borgo delle Meraviglie

Events, shows and fun in Cortellazzo

A real child-friendly Christmas village. This is what awaits you in Cortellazzo, where the extraordinary Village of Wonders has been prepared and set up for the holidays.

Throughout the Christmas period, there will be no shortage of shows, children’s readings, entertainment, fun shows and rides for the little ones. Events take place in Grenadier Square, starting at 2 p.m. and admission is free.

Lots of events not to be missed: the magic begins on Sunday, Dec. 8, during the day the village hosts a craft market amid entertainment games and merriment, there will also be a meeting with Santa Claus and the traditional delivery of letters.

On Sunday, Dec. 11, Santa Claus will collect the last letters, there will then be children’s readings by Ketty Montagner and a demonstration of dynamic military gymnastics in a Christmas version, an all-Italian sport that has distinguished our country’s sports history.

On Sunday, Dec. 18, Santa Claus will greet the children before returning to the North Pole and, for those in attendance, there is then the Carrot Show, the show full of magic where joy and fun are assured. Monday, Dec. 26, the stars will be the clown Pikkio and his creations, followed by a live performance by Valeria Cosenza.

Thursday, Jan. 5, “La Befana vien di notte con le scarpe tutte rotte…”: socks for all the children and traditional pan e vin!
